It looks fine to me. After a few days I would cold crash it for 12-24 hours before pitching time and decant the supernatant, and just pitch the yeast slurry. Use an online yest calculator to find out how much you need. For a typical 5 gallon lager I'm going to say that you need a bigger starter. You can cold crash your starter after a few days and decant like above, but instead of pitching, pour more boiled and chilled starter wort on top of the yeast slurry, and let it grow again for a few more days.
